New Canaan Community Foundation announced the exceptional honorees for the 2026 Volunteer Recognition Awards in a celebration at Town Hall on March 4, 2026. These hometown heroes have dedicated their time and energy to making our community a better place.
2026 New Canaan Volunteer Recognition Awards Honorees include:
Youth Rookie of the Year – Will Taylor, Open Doors
Board Leadership MVP – Tom Reynolds, New Canaan Land Trust
Hands-On Hall of Fame – Terri Leopold, Person to Person
Hands-On MVP – Susan Freedgood, New Canaan Museum & Historical Society
Community Initiative – Scott Hobbs, New Canaan Housing Authority
Hands-On MVP – Michael Canoro, New Canaan Library
Hands-On Hall of Fame – Martha Porretta, Waveny LifeCare Network
Hands-On Rookie of the Year – Marshall Pask, Staying Put in New Canaan
Youth MVP – Jordan Alexander, Building One Community
Outstanding Group – Jill Robey, Flower Again Connecticut
Outstanding Youth Group – Dante Marsili & Graysen Handler, Feeding 500 New Canaan
Youth Rookie of the Year – Cassie Arevalo, Waveny Lifecare Network
New Canaan Community Foundation’s “Small Business, Big Impact” – Sean Brennan, C & H Automotive
New Canaan Community Foundation’s “Impact” – Ali Luddy
